		<description>I probably spent more money renting The Legend of the Mystical Ninja than it would have cost to buy it when I was a kid.  This game is an amazing blend of sidescrollers, puzzle, and RPG elements that is great with one or two players.  There are also a ton of minigames (even Gradius!) along with the entertaining and humorous straightforward gameplay.  

It's a definate buy for me and a great title, especially for eight bucks!
